摘要
A new method of production of precise piezoelectric quartz resonators and filters, and monolithic piezoquartz filters with electrodes, made of electroless nickel-phosphorous alloy, for spacecraft, hydroacoustics and communication devices was developed. Electrical characteristics of quartz resonators with the deposited Ni-P coating are better than when gold and silver were used as electrode layers. A method of electroless deposition on polished quartz, glass and other nonmetallic polished materials was developed. Bulk and miniature resonators of piezoquartz and lithium niobate manufactured on the basis of the developed technology of electroless deposition of a nickel-phosphorus alloy, instead of gold and silver plating, were successfully used in industry. The technology was developed for the production of piezoceramic and ceramic devices by electroless deposition of electrode layers made of Ni-P or Cu.
